Alsco Uniforms Earns Recognition at the 2026 TRSA Industry Awards
Alsco Uniforms, a prominent name in laundry and facility services, has achieved notable success at the 2026 TRSA Industry Awards, where it was honored with multiple prestigious awards acknowledging its excellence in service, sustainability, and overall leadership. This recognition not only underscores their industry leadership but also highlights their commitment to sustainable practices.
The awards, presented by the Textile Rental Services Association (TRSA), a well-respected non-profit trade organization representing linen, uniform, and facility service providers worldwide, celebrate outstanding achievements in the industry. Alsco’s accolades at the ceremony serve as a testament to their unwavering commitment to service and environmental stewardship.
Chief Operating Officer Jim Kearns expressed the company's pride in receiving such esteemed awards, stating, "We are honored to be part of TRSA, and we are proud of our teams for earning these awards. These recognitions validate our commitment to sustainability as a core value through our focus on reusable products and services."
The awards won by Alsco include:
- - 2026 Above & Beyond Service Award, Gold Level: This honor was awarded to the Austin, Texas branch and was accepted by Jim Kearns himself.
- - 2026 TRSA Voluntary Leadership Award, Gold Level: This award was presented to Senior National Sales Manager Ryan Mathews.
- - 2026 Video Excellence Award, Gold Level: Alsco Uniforms Brasil took home this award, accepted by their CEO, Bob Steiner.
- - 2026 Clean Green Sustainability Award, Gold Level: This prestigious award was granted to Alsco Uniforms Australia, with Chief Financial Officer Andrew Steiner accepting it on their behalf.
In addition to these gold-level awards, Alsco Uniforms also garnered silver-level recognitions and honorable mentions in areas related to service engagement and sustainability leadership.
"It's especially meaningful to see our international locations represented on this stage," commented Bob Steiner, underscoring the importance of their global presence. "These awards reflect the commitment, innovation, and service mindset of our teams around the world."

About Alsco Uniforms
Founded in 1889, Alsco Uniforms is a family-operated company that has played a pivotal role in shaping the uniform and linen rental industry. With a legacy of over 135 years, Alsco continues to innovate and provide high-quality laundry services across various sectors. Their commitment to customer satisfaction has made them a trusted partner for more than 350,000 customers in 13 countries.
